Output c39da2f6aac7091c06e63877e0aefcb1d66ef69735996f29c9ede29e5016842b:1

value
24604858
script pubkey
OP_0 OP_PUSHBYTES_20 6ef1214b211058e0d37c161436d4ef9d16c7e8bf
address
bc1qdmcjzjepzpvwp5muzc2rd480n5tv069lea9a2a
transaction
c39da2f6aac7091c06e63877e0aefcb1d66ef69735996f29c9ede29e5016842b
confirmations
100093
spent
true